var game = new Phaser.Game(800, 600, Phaser.CANVAS, 'phaser-example', { preload: preload, create: create, render: render });
function preload() {
game.load.spritesheet('button', 'assets/buttons/button_sprite_sheet.png', 193, 71);
game.load.image('background','assets/misc/starfield.jpg');
}
var button;
var background;
function create() {
game.stage.backgroundColor = '#182d3b';
background = game.add.tileSprite(0, 0, 800, 600, 'background');
button = game.add.button(game.world.centerX - 95, 200, 'button', actionOnClick, this, 2, 1, 0);
button.anchor.setTo(0.5, 0.5);
button.scale.setTo(2, 2);
// button.width = 100;
// button.height = 300;
button.angle = 10;
}
function actionOnClick () {
background.visible =! background.visible;
}
function render () {
game.debug.renderSpriteCorners(button);
game.debug.renderPoint(button.input._tempPoint);
}
